The Clearing Post-Trade Services and Risk team operates within CME Group's Clearing House and oversees daily trade processing for futures/options and over-the-counter (OTC) derivatives, ensuring the timely clearing of customer transactions and performing key risk management functions. The Clearing House guarantees its member firms meet their financial obligations for all open positions, as well as offering various clearing services to drive efficiencies for CME Group's customers.
The Post-Trade Services and Risk Analyst will be working on two new initiatives with CME Group. The analyst will be monitoring risk and systems for our new Event Contracts suite over the weekend. Responsibilities will include strategic planning and design of clearing systems, operational and risk management, development of operational risk governance documents, and engaging internal stakeholders and external market participants.
